Manufacturing

The manufacturing industry has been integrating automation into its operations for the past decade, and it is just going to increase. The use of robotics will see a rapid increase in the sector, especially as the pandemic has shown how human labor can be unreliable. The use of robots for tasks such as assembly, painting, and packaging among others, will provide an accurate and faster production process. Manufacturers are also adopting cloud-based solutions to streamline their processes.

Healthcare

Automation and robotics are expected to bring about a paradigm shift in the healthcare industry. Robots and automation tools can perform multiple functions such as providing medication, monitoring patients, assisting in surgeries and rehabilitating patients. Automation in healthcare will make healthcare more accessible at a lower cost, save time and improve the quality of care. According to Global News Wire The global healthcare automation market grew from $57.24 billion in 2022 to $63.41 billion in 2023 and will continue beyond.

Agriculture

As the world population grows, so does the demand for food. The agricultural industry must find effective ways to increase productivity to meet the needs and demands of a larger population. Automation provides a solution. Automation and robotics help in activities like planting, harvesting, fertilizing and even chemical application. Automated technology in agriculture provides higher crop yield, better production quality, and safer working conditions.

Logistics and warehousing

With the growth of e-commerce and online shopping, the logistics and warehousing industry has seen significant growth in demand for its services. Automation and robotics have been used to streamline the process of managing goods, from stocking on shelves to packing the order for customers. Automation also provides significant cost reduction, error reduction and fast processing of customer orders.

Construction

Automation and robotics are impacting the construction industry positively. Robots are used in concrete or bricklaying, painting, welding, and excavation. A robot does not need rest like humans, which makes it more efficient. Automation in construction means better quality control, faster completion times or projects and increased safety on site.
